AI Summary
-
Prohibits local and regional boards of education from charging student activity fees to students who do not participate in athletic activities or extracurricular activities funded by those fees, effective July 1, 2011
-
Prohibits school districts from charging any fees to students who demonstrate an inability to pay such fees
-
Updates terminology in Section 10-221 of the general statutes from "boards" to "local and regional boards of education" and from "pupils" to "students" throughout
-
Maintains existing authority for school districts to charge students for damaged or lost textbooks, library materials, and other educational materials
Legislative Description
An Act Prohibiting School Districts From Charging Universal, Nonrefundable Student Fees.
